Overview

The Vimar VM01989 is a DIN-rail supply unit that outputs 29 VDC at up to 1280 mA for onboard control networks that run on a 29 V bus.

It takes 120-230 V~ input at 50/60 Hz, so it is typically fed from the boat’s AC distribution (shore power or an inverter-fed panel) and used to power the low-voltage bus for automation devices.

Built for DIN (60715 TH35) rail mounting and sized for 8 DIN modules (8 x 17.5 mm), it is intended for a protected electrical cabinet where wiring stays organized and service access is straightforward.

Installation and setup

Mount the unit on a 60715 TH35 DIN rail inside a protected distribution cabinet. Allow room for wiring bends and airflow, and avoid locations exposed to direct spray, washdowns, or persistent condensation.

Connect the AC input from a correctly protected circuit, then land the 29 VDC output to the bus power feed points for your installation. When the system is split into two lines, keep line routing consistent with the intended segmentation so troubleshooting stays simple later.

Electrical and system integration

This is not a 12 V or 24 V DC supply for typical boat loads. It is an AC-powered unit that provides 29 VDC, which matches control and building-automation style buses used on many modern yachts, including KNX-based setups.

If the vessel is primarily DC-only, plan for how the AC feed will be provided (for example via an inverter) before committing panel space.

Compatibility and fit

With an 8-module footprint on the DIN rail, confirm available cabinet space and layout alongside breakers, terminals, and other DIN devices. It is a solid match for centralized electrical lockers where lighting controls, switching, and other automation components share a dedicated 29 V bus supply.

Maintenance and care

As part of routine electrical checks, verify the rail latch is secure and that terminals remain tight. In saltwater environments, keeping the cabinet dry and well ventilated helps limit corrosion at connections over time.
